Can Carb and Fat Blockers Deliver?

The weight-loss industry is swamped with remedies promising rapid transformation. Among these are carb and fat blockers, claimed to hinder your body from consuming carbohydrates and fats. But do these products truly work? The answer is nuanced.

While some studies suggest that carb and fat blockers may have a limited effect on calorie intake, the evidence is far from definitive. Many factors can influence their effectiveness, including personal metabolism, diet composition, and the specific ingredients in the product.

  • Moreover, long-term use of carb and fat blockers may have unintended consequences for your health, such as nutrient lacks.
  • Finally, it's crucial to consult with a healthcare professional before taking any weight-loss supplement, including carb and fat blockers.

Focus on building a balanced lifestyle that includes a balanced diet and regular exercise for lasting results.
